Had A question for any USA Fender Geddy Lee Jazz bassist, I noticed on my strings the "A" string to the "D" string is a wider gap/distance and makes it a little harder to jump from those strings and I assume it might be a faulty badass bridge they come with. I looked bass all over and came to that conclusion, maybe I should take a chance and buy another badass bridge? anybody have this problem? I have seen other pics and a lot don't seem like they have that gap problem but some do anybody?
 
FWIW, I'll measure it, here in a bit. You just want between the A and D, or all?
between the A and D on mine the distance is 4.5 marks more on my guitar measuring tool than E to A and D to G I think if the A string was those 4 marks closer to the A string it would be perfect.
 
Last edited:
I am not sure what 4.5 marks means. You should have 19.5mm or about 3/4 of an inch at the bridge. No reason for those to be out of whack all of a sudden. Did you buy the bass like that?
Did you adjust your saddle height on on side and not the other? Perhaps a picture would allow further help.
it came like that and after jaming my rickenbacker...most excellent bass BTW I noticed my geddy lee felt more of a struggle to play then noticed the string width so i went ahead and found a leo quan badass bass bridge II and then I called fender to confirm it would fit my USA geddy lee jazz and they said it would also considering geddys bass was designed from his 72 bass he had so they said it should be a perfect fit. hope so, I just ordered it :)

19 mm between both the E and A, and the D and G, and lo and behold...

... 20.5 mm between the A and D.
